Job SummaryProvide administrative support to the various Collin College Deans of Student and Enrollment Services and respective departments. Ensure compliance with state and institutional policies and procedures.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Assist students, staff, faculty and the general public with correct information and direction regarding college and student enrollment services in person and over the telephone in a friendly and professional manner. Represent the Dean of Student and Enrollment Services in communications with stakeholders.
- Provide diverse administrative support to departments as requested. Schedule meetings and make appointments. Produce a variety of documents and reports. Assist with special projects and presentations.
- Assist the Dean with inputting and monitoring the annual budget. Maintain inventory records for the division. Review financial data.
- Purchase supplies and equipment for the Division, as needed, through Cougar Mart Purchasing System and College Bookstore.
- Process division purchase requisitions.
- Receive invoices and assist vendors with billing questions.
- Travel between campuses to attend meetings, workshops, and seminars as required.
- Maintain the division's organizational chart.
- Follow up on leave and travel forms, check requests, and other forms to ensure receipt of items and/or completion of requests as appropriate.
- Assist with reviewing time sheets for accuracy and signatures, and forward forms to Payroll Office by the due date.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
- Perform all duties to maintain all standards in accordance with College policies, procedures and Core Values.
